Thales S.A. stock (FR0000121329): French aerospace group in focus after new air traffic management partnership
28.05.2026 - 14:35:41 | ad-hoc-news.deThales S.A. shares on Euronext Paris were in focus after the French aerospace and defense group highlighted a new collaboration with École Nationale de l'Aviation Civile (ENAC) to co-develop future air traffic management solutions, underscoring France's role as a hub for aviation technology according to a Thales press release dated 05/27/2026.
The company, headquartered in Paris and a member of the French industrial landscape with its primary listing on Euronext Paris under the ticker HO, is using this partnership to expand its research and training capabilities in air traffic management and to address growing demand for safer and more efficient skies according to the same Thales communication as of 05/27/2026.
The collaboration with ENAC, a leading French civil aviation university, is intended to develop advanced systems and training programs that can help manage air traffic in increasingly congested airspace, reflecting France's strategic focus on aerospace and air traffic technologies as highlighted by Thales on 05/27/2026.
In parallel to developments in France, Thales continues to win international contracts, such as projects in Slovenia for air traffic radar and sonar projects in Canada, showing that the group is active in key NATO and allied markets according to recent sector news compiled on 05/28/2026.

Thales S.A.: core business model
Thales primarily designs and supplies advanced defense, aerospace, and digital security systems, with revenue largely generated from long-term government defense contracts, civil aviation equipment, and digital identity solutions for clients across Europe and other key regions.
Industry trends and competitive position
The air traffic management and aerospace technology sector is undergoing a transition toward more digital, data-driven, and sustainable solutions, as airspace authorities and airlines seek to reduce delays, optimize routes, and cut emissions, trends that Thales is targeting with its ENAC partnership announced on 05/27/2026.
Within this landscape, Thales competes with other global aerospace and defense groups by offering integrated radar, navigation, surveillance, and communication solutions, and the new initiative with ENAC is positioned to support research and training that can help maintain the company's competitive stance in both French and international air traffic management projects.
